till和until都表示“直到”,常可换用,但till不用于句首,也不可用于强调句。
a. until/till从句或短语与肯定的主句连用时,主句的谓语必须是延续性动词,表示主句的动作一直持续到until/till所表示的时间为止。如:
He remained there till she arrived.他一直待在那里直到她来。
You may stay here until the rain stops.你可在这里呆到雨停。
He waited until(it was) ten o'clock.他一直等到十点钟。
b. until/till从句或短语与否定的主句连用时,主句的谓语必须是非延续性动词,表示“直到……才,在……之前不……”,即主句的动作到until/till所表示的时间时才开始。如:
He won't go to bed till(until)she returns.直到她回来他才去睡。
I didn't leave until he came back.直到他回来我才离开。
He didn't come until he had gone over his lesson.他一直到复习完了功课才来。